    NULL Pointer Dereference

    PyMuPDF is an A high performance Python library for data extraction, analysis, conversion & manipulation of PDF (and other) documents.

    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to NULL Pointer Dereference via the break_word_for_overflow_wrap() function when rendering a malformed EPUB document. An attacker can cause a crash by supplying a specially crafted EPUB file that triggers a null pointer dereference in the processing of FLOW_WORD nodes.

    How to fix NULL Pointer Dereference?

    A fix was pushed into the master branch but not yet published.
